We have observed an anomalous broadening of the NMR absorption line of diluted ortho-H z (with rotational angular momentum J :-1) in solid para-H 2 (J = O) as pressure is applied. Samples with 0.015 < x < 0.06, where x is the ortho mole fraction, were studied over the temperature range 1.2 < T < 4.2
